Ingredients:
1 cup corn kernels
2 tbsp corn flour
1 tbsp rice flour
water as required
1/2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p pepper
oil for deep frying
How to make crispy corn:
Remove the corn kernels from the cob.
Add 3 cups of water in a sauce pan and bring it to boil.
Then add corn kernels. Boil for 6-7 minutes, so that corn cooks till soft. Otherwise, when we dip in flour and add to oil it pops and oil splutters which is not safe.
Once it's boiled, strain the water out.
Meanwhile, to a mixing bowl, add rice flour, corn flour, salt and pepper.
Crumble the mixture together.
Then add water little by little.
Mix it to a thick pouring consistency.
Add boiled corn kernels and mix well.
Let the corns be coated with flour.
Heat oil in a wok or kadai till it's hot. Slowly add the dipped corn kernels in small batches.
Let it cook on medium flame till crisp.
It changes the color slightly. Then remove it from oil.
Sprinkle some salt and optionally any spice powders of your choice like chat masala, red chilli powder or garam masala. If serving for kids and toddlers, serve it as such without any spices.
Serve the crispy corn when it's warm as a tea time snack.
